  • After purchasing Toms 70’s Lotus Elite on his previous visit, Gary returns to complete the deal on a rare manual Porsche 928 GT. Will treating this 90’s supercar to its first wash in thirty years reveal a list of hidden surprises?

    • @rongill4199
      @rongill4199 Год назад +2

      Make sure you check that the torque tube is set correctly as they can kill the engine if the tube moves forwards pushing onto the end of the crankshaft🥵

    • @nigelha3699
      @nigelha3699 Год назад +1

      @@rongill4199 true, its mostly an auto thing - there are a lot more of them, but manuals do it too. Its actually the rear bolt that losses its torque, not the front. Look for red dust. Replace bolt every few years, no locktite either.
